Key Responsibilities:

Talent Development & Training Programs:

  •  Design, develop, and implement talent development programs that address skill gaps and improve employee performance.
     
  •  Develop leadership and management training programs to build future leaders.
     
  •  Oversee the Trainee Manager Program, ensuring effective curriculum design and assessment.
     
  •  Conduct training needs assessments and create customized learning plans.
     
  •  Implement training solutions through workshops, e-learning, mentorship, and other learning formats.
     
  • Collaborate with department heads to establish performance standards and evaluation systems.
     
  •  Provide guidance on setting clear performance goals and conducting performance reviews.
     
  •  Design tools to assess training effectiveness and measure progress against objectives.
     
  •  Develop strategies to improve employee engagement, motivation, and productivity.
     
  •  Identify high-potential employees and create individualized development plans.
     
  •  Develop succession planning strategies to ensure readiness for key positions.
     
  • Monitor talent pipelines and maintain accurate records of employee progress.
     
  • Recommend initiatives to retain top talent and reduce turnover.
     
  • Partner with HR and department heads to identify training needs across various functions.
     
  •  Ensure effective communication of training programs and development opportunities.
     
  • Provide coaching and mentoring support to employees as needed.
     
  • Continuously assess and enhance training methodologies to achieve desired outcomes.
     
  •  Monitor and evaluate employee performance improvement post-training 

Qualifications & Requirements: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Hotel Management, Business Administration, Organizational Development, or related field.
     
  •  Proven experience as a Talent Development Manager, Training Manager, or related role.
     
  • Excellent communication, presentation, and interpersonal skills.
     
  • Familiarity with or hands-on experience in various hotel departments (e.g., Front Office, Housekeeping, Food & Beverage, etc.
     
  • Experience in the hospitality industry is a plus
